Change History
Changes made from version 3.20 to 3.41:
- Fixed a connectivity issue that could cause ANT+ or BLE sensors to lose connection and never reconnect.
- Fixed an issue with Bluetooth communication that was impacting phone connectivity and device power down stability.
- Fixed a shutdown that could occur when calculating a route.
- Updated the sensor pairing user interface to encourage pairing over ANT+.
Changes made from version 3.20 to 3.33:
- Fixes connectivity issues that could have caused ANT+ or BLE sensors to lose connection and never reconnect.
- Fixes an issue that caused Bluetooth communication to lock up, which could have affected phone connectivity and device power down.
- Improved performance in GPS + GALILEO mode.
Installation Instructions
- Connect your Edge 830 device to your computer using the micro-USB cable.
- Download and unzip Edge830_341Beta.zip and place the GUPDATE.gcd file in the \Garmin folder of your device's internal storage drive.
- Disconnect your device from the computer, approve the update on the Edge, and wait for the update to finish.
- If you would like to revert to the last public release software, follow the above steps but place the GUPDATE-320.GCD file in the \Garmin folder. Rename the file to GUPDATE.GCD before disconnecting your device.
NOTE: If you revert to an older version of software, all of your settings will be reset to defaults.
